These results reflect ongoing high demand for office space in Frankfurt. The last time we saw similar take-up levels was in This record result can mainly be attributed to large-scale leases signed for more than 10,000 sq m. The largest-scale single lease of the year was signed in Q4 by Deutsche Bundesbank for around 44,400 sq m of office space at the Frankfurter Büro Center. Similar to the previous year, Deutsche Bahn was particularly active, signing two leases for just over 30,000 sq m and 23,000 sq m at new-build developments in Europaviertel. 4 The CBD remains particularly popular among tenants. The Banking District, Westend and City submarkets posted around 298,000 sq m in take-up combined, or 42 %. Other submarkets, such as Europaviertel and Kaiserlei, benefited from high-volume single-asset deals. After getting off to a slow start in, the banking sector became the most active tenant group in Frankfurt as expected, claiming more than 20 % of total take-up, even though we have yet to see an increase in the number of new leases signed by international banks in the wake of Brexit. Consulting firms secured second place among the most active sectors with more than 115,000 sq m in take-up. Construction and real estate proved the third-strongest sector in. The real estate sector was able to more than double its take-up yoy. This outstanding result can largely be attributed to leases signed by coworking space providers and business centers. The leases signed by WeWork in the Banking District had a particularly strong impact on the market. 5 Key Developments Completion rates are far from being able to compensate for shrinking supply with the 82,200 sq m of office space completed in already completely taken-up by tenants or owner-occupiers. As things currently stand, completion volumes in 2018 are expected to increase to 127,600 sq m, but the majority of this additional space (72 %) already has been leased as well. Significant amounts of space will be added to the market until 2019 with the OMNITURM and Marieninsel property developments. However, tenants are already showing considerable interest in these products. Summary and Outlook The office leasing market benefited from high demand across all sectors in, posting a result that was well above average. We expect this trend to continue in 2018 with limited construction activity turning tenant focus to stock buildings, causing the drop in vacancy rates to continue. If interest in central locations remains strong in 2018, we can also expect average rents to continue to rise. That puts commercial transaction volume up 13 % from an already strong previous year result. This growth trend has been ongoing now for 8 years. Mega-deals remained the key driving force behind market activity in, accounting for more than 100 m. 16 deals of this magnitude were signed in the past 12 months, bringing in almost half of total transaction volume. This solid result can be attributed to several high-rise deals including Japan Center and the T8 and T11 towers in Taunusanlage. The acquisition of Tower 185 by Deka Immobilien deserved particular mention: Going for roughly 775 m, this deal was by far the largest single transaction of the year. 6 Open-ended real estate funds and special funds were the most active investor groups with transaction volume at just over 1.8 bn and a market share of more than 26 %. Their high ranking can largely be attributed to the acquisition of Tower 185 by several Deka funds. Asset/fund managers took second place with a transaction volume of roughly 1.4 bn, often acted on behalf of foreign investors as in previous years. REITs trailed behind to claim third place with a transaction volume of around 790 m. The breakdown is similar sell-side with real estate funds and asset/fund managers occupying the two top spots. Property developers played a significant role in the past 12 months as well, taking advantage of the current market situation and disposing of assets valued at just shy of 960 m. That put them in third place sell-side. In terms of location, market activity tended to revolve around Banking District as in previous years with this submarket claiming almost 25 % of transaction volume. The growing significance of submarkets outside the CBD was again apparent in. Only two of the five largest deals signed were actually located in the Banking District. Peripheral locations such as Niederrad and Eschborn, benefited from the shortage of assets in top locations and managed to clearly exceed previous year s results. Yields Yield compression continued as the result of the ongoing euphoria on the investment market. (Gross) prime yields for office properties in the CBD fell 50 bp down from the previous quarter to a current 3.30 %. Frankfurt s submarkets posted prime yields of 4.2 % at the end of year. Logistics assets also saw strong yield compression, again bringing prime yields down to 4.65 %. 7 Glossary Take-up of Space Take-up of space is the sum of all spaces either newly let, sold to owner-occupiers, or built for or by an owner-occupier within the period under consideration. The salient date is that on which the lease or purchase agreement is signed. The renewal of an existing lease is not counted in the take-up of space. Leasing performance Leasing performance reflects take-up excluding owner-occupied space. Prime Rent The premium rent represents the median of the top 3 % of new lets (not counting owner-occupiers) during the 12 months just ended. Average Rent The average rent is calculated by taking the individual rents agreed to in all new leases, weighting them by the amount of space rented and computing the mean value. Vacancy Vacancy is defined as all office space available for occupation within three months. Prime yields Prime yields are the best return that can be realized for a property of highest quality and in the best location when leased under usual market conditions (highly solvent tenant). The figures here are gross yields.
